Before retiring in Lugano, expats should be aware that the cost of living is high, and that the city is home to a large number of wealthy residents. Expats should also be aware that the city is located in the Italian-speaking part of Switzerland, and that the official language is Italian. Additionally, expats should be aware that Lugano is a popular tourist destination, and that the city is known for its mild climate and stunning views of the Alps. Finally, expats should be aware that the city is home to a vibrant cultural scene, with a variety of museums, galleries, and theaters.
